Robotaxi Race Heats Up: Amazon's Zoox To Launch Paid Rides In US Next Week

Amazon's Zoox is set to begin charging passengers for rides in its fully autonomous vehicles next week, marking a significant step in the commercial rollout of robotaxis. This move intensifies competition in the self-driving sector, challenging established players like Waymo and Tesla.
